Which of the following best defines the term “active citizen”?

History
2 answers:
Anastaziya [24]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

<em>C. A productive member of his/her community and society</em><em> is the option that best defines the term “active citizen”.</em>

Explanation:

The concept of <u>active citizenship</u> refers to the roles and responsibilities the members of organizations, companies or states adopt in their society and environment. This role is an active one, since these citizens take iniciative in issues regarding the public concern.

What was one of the major causes of death along the trail of tears for the cherokee people?
Kruka [31]
The correct answer is C. Harsh weather .

The Trail of Tears was a journey of over a thousand miles for the Cherokee people. This journey resulted in the Cherokee moving from their ancestral homeland of Georgia to modern day Oklahoma. This journey took a significant amount of time and resulted in many deaths due to the brutal cold faced by the Cherokee when marching to Oklahoma. Along with this, the lack of adequate clothing and shelter along this journey ensured that the tough weather conditions would have a significant impact on these people.
